Webb9 nov. 2024 · We combined this with further research into global language use statistics to bring you all of the most up-to-date facts and figures on the topic of bilingualism and … Webb13 dec. 2024 · One of the most recent and striking discoveries is that bilingualism may delay the onset of Alzheimer’s disease. Alzheimer’s disease involves memory loss and other cognitive disabilities that develop slowly and get worse over time. Numerous studies have found that the onset of Alzheimer’s disease is delayed by 4-5 years in bilingual ...
